Trichomoniasis is a protozoal infection. It's not caused by a bacteria, and a bacterial infection can't turn into trichomoniasis.
Turmeric does not cause trichomoniasis. Trichomoniasis is an infection typically spread by sexual contact.
MRSA stands for methicilin-resistant staph aureus. MRSA is a type of staph, and a MRSA infection is a kind of staph infection.
Yes, trichomoniasis is caused by a protozoa. The organism is Trichomonas vaginalis.
A bladder infection can't turn into trichomoniasis. Trich can cause many symptoms similar to UTI, though.
